Inpatient drug rehab, also known as residential drug rehab, is a treatment method for people that require a change of environment and receive very comprehensive treatment. Inpatient rehab in Caldwell commonly lasts anywhere from 1 month to several months, and some programs provide both short and long term treatment options. Additionally, some inpatient facilities are prepared to provide both drug free and medically assisted detox services, although some only accept individuals who have already been detoxed at a detox center prior to arrival.
Within an inpatient residential drug rehab, it is a lot like a small community of clients and staff who are functioning together through the course of recovery. Professional staff do a thorough evaluation of the patient's issues, and a rehabilitation strategy is put forth that may include therapy, counseling, holistic treatment, psychotherapy, etc. dependent upon what rehabilitation method the rehab center is employing. Many inpatient programs concentrate on the 12 steps, while others employ a therapeutic behavioral approach, which could involve the latest developments in addiction therapies.
Inpatient drug rehab also reduces the risks of relapse, since the person is continually supervised in a clean and sober environment, and won't have access to any of the friends or drug dealers who motivated, encouraged or enabled their drug use.
